The Fort St John RCMP are asking for the public’s help in identifying a suspect and vehicle involved in an alleged attempted abduction in Taylor.

On Monday May 6 around 9:15pm, a male suspect, driving a smaller tan coloured pickup truck, offered a walking youth a ride.

When the youth declined, the male driver made additional verbal attempts to get the youth into the vehicle. The suspect fled the scene headed toward Fort St John, BC.

The suspect male driver is described as:

Caucasian,
Mid 40’s,
Wearing a black and white bushy beard,
Balding,
Having a shorter stature,
Weighing approximately 250lbs.

The suspect vehicle was described as:

A smaller, tan-coloured pickup truck with rust spots.

The Fort St John RCMP continue to investigate and request the public’s assistance in providing information on possible sightings of the suspect vehicle and male driver.

If you have any additional information in relation to the described suspect, vehicle, or incident, please contact the Fort St John RCMP at 250-787-8100.
